Spiral fractures of the distal shaft of the fifth metatarsal are common injuries and can usually be treated nonoperatively for these high performance athletes without long-term functional sequelae. In all, 142 acute fractures were managed for an incidence of 4.8% of all metatarsal fractures. Patients were seen at 6 and 12 weeks, and a minimum 2-year follow-up was conducted. Common mechanisms for having metatarsal shaft fracture(s) include falling from a high height and landing on the feet, jamming the foot into the brake pedals in the course of a motor vehicle collision, loading the foot and twisting it in the course of changing directions during a sporting event, andmost commonly, dropping a heavy object on the forefoot. Nonoperative management has been the preferred treatment for displaced oblique spiral fractures of the fifth metatarsal shaft; yet a paucity of literature supports this claim.
